Spicy Red Lentil Soup with Coconut Milk
Warm up on a chilly day with this flavorful and spicy red lentil soup infused with the creamy richness of coconut milk.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 medium onions, chopped
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 red bell pepper, diced
– 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
– 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
– 1 can (15 oz) coconut milk
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Fresh cilantro, chopped (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té the onions, garlic, and bell pepper in a little oil until softened.
2. Add the lentils, cumin, smoked paprika, and cayenne pepper. Cook for 1 minute.
3. Pour in the diced tomatoes, coconut milk, and vegetable broth.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 30-40 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
4.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ot, garnished with chopped cilantro if desired.
Cooking Time: 45-50 minutes
Garlicky Red Lentil Curry with Spinach
This flavorful curry is a perfect blend of Indian spices, garlic, and tender red lentils, finished with a burst of fresh spinach. Serve over basmati rice or with naan bread for a satisfying meal.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 medium onions, chopped
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on curry powder
– 1/2 teaspoon turmeric
– 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
– 1 can diced tomatoes (14 oz)
– 2 cups water or vegetable broth
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Fresh spinach leaves, chopped (about 1 cup)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té onions and garlic until softened.
2. Add cumin, curry powder, turmeric, and cayenne pepper (if using). Cook for 1 minute.
3. Add lentils, diced tomatoes, water or broth,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il, then simmer for 30-40 minutes or until lentils are tender.
4. Stir in chopped spinach and cook until wilted.
5. Serve hot over rice or with naan bread.
Cooking Time: 45-50 minutes
Creamy Red Lentil Hummus
This creamy dip is a delicious twist on traditional hummus, packed with the nutritional benefits of red lentils. Perfect for veggie sticks or pita chips, it’s also a great addition to your favorite sandwiches and wraps.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1/4 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ice
– 1/4 cup tahini
– 1/4 cup olive oil
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 3 tablespoons water
Instructions:
1. In a medium saucepan, combine lentils and 2 cups of water.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 20-25 minutes or until tender.
2. Drain the lentils and let them cool slightly.
3. In a blender or food processor, combine cooled lentils, garlic, lemon juice, tahini, olive oil, salt, and 1 tablespoon of water.
4. Blend on high speed until smooth and creamy, adding more water if needed to achieve desired consistency.
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es
Red Lentil and Vegetable Stew
This flavorful and nutritious stew is a perfect blend of tender lentils, colorful vegetables, and aromatic spices. It’s an ideal comfort food for a chilly evening or a quick weeknight dinner.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 medium carrots, chopped
– 1 large celery stalk, chopped
– 1 medium on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té the onion, carrots, and celery in a little water until tender.
2. Add the garlic, lentils, diced tomatoes, vegetable broth, c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ir well.
3.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 30-40 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
4.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
5.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ley if desired.
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es
Red Lentil Bolognese with Pasta
Experience the rich flavor of a traditional Italian Bolognese sauce reimagined with red lentils, creating a nutritious and satisfying vegetarian meal. This recipe is per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a special occasion.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 carrot, finely chopped
– 1 can (28 oz) crushed tomatoes
– 1 teaspoon tomato paste
– 1 teaspoon dried basil
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 8 oz pasta of your choice (e.g., spaghetti or pappardelle)
– Grated Parmesan cheese, optional
Instructions:
1. Cook the lentils according to package instructions until tender. Drain and set aside.
2.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onion, garlic, and carrot; cook until the vegetables are soft, about 5 minutes.
3. Add the crushed tomatoes, tomato paste, basil, salt, and pepper. Stir to combine.
4. Add the cooked lentils to the sauce and stir to coat.
5. Cook pasta according to package instructions. Serve with the Red Lentil Bolognese sauce and top with Parmesan cheese, if desired.
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es
Red Lentil and Sweet Potato Patties
These flavorful patties are a great way to incorporate more plant-based protein and fiber into your diet. Made with red lentils, sweet potatoes, and aromatic spices, they’re perfect for a quick snack or meal.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up cooked red lentils
– 2 medium sweet potatoes, cooked and mashed
– 1/4 cup rolled oats
– 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
– 1/2 teaspoon cumin
– 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
Instructions:
1. In a large bowl, combine cooked lentils, mashed sweet potatoes, oats, parsley, c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
2. Mix well until a thick batter forms.
3. Using your hands, shape the mixture into 6-8 patties.
4. Heat the olive oil in a non-stick skillet over medium heat.
5. Cook the patties for 3-4 minutes per side, or until golden brown and crispy.
6. Serve hot with your favorite toppings, such as hummus, avocado, or salsa.
Cooking Time: 12-15 minutes
Moroccan-Spiced Red Lentil Soup
Warm up with a flavorful and aromatic Moroccan-inspired red lentil soup, infused with the rich spices of the region. This comforting bowl is perfect for a cozy night in.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ils
– 4 cups water or vegetable broth
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 1 on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on ground coriander
– 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
– 1/4 teaspoon ground cayenne pepper (optional)
– Salt and black pepper to taste
– Fresh parsley or cilantro for garnish (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add onion and cook until softened, about 5 minutes.
2. Add garlic, cumin, coriander, cinnamon, and cayenne pepper (if using). Cook for an additional minute, stirring constantly.
3. Add lentils, water or broth, salt, and black pepper.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 30-40 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.
4. Serve hot, garnished with parsley or cilantro if desired.
Cooking Time: 40 minutes
Red Lentil Dal with Cumin and Turmeric
This classic Indian-inspired dal recipe is a flavorful and nutritious option for a quick weeknight dinner or lunch. The combination of red lentils, aromatic spices, and sautéed onions creates a comforting and satisfying meal.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 cups water
– 1 small on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on turmeric powder
– Salt, to taste
– 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, combine lentils and water.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 20-25 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
2. Heat oil in a pan over medium heat. Add onion and cook until softened, about 5 minutes.
3. Add garlic, cumin, and turmeric to the pan. C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ly.
4. Stir the cooked spice mixture into the cooked lentils.
5. Season with salt to taste. Serve hot over rice or with naan bread.
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es

Red Lentil and Mushroom Burgers
This recipe combines the nutty flavor of red lentils with the earthy taste of mushrooms to create a deliciously textured burger patty. Perfect for a vegetarian or vegan option, these burgers are packed with protein and fiber.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up cooked red lentils
– 1/2 cup cooked mushrooms (such as cremini or shiitake), finely chopped
– 1/4 cup rolled oats
– 1 tablespoon tomato paste
–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1 egg, lightly beaten (or flaxseed equivalent for vegan option)
– Cooking spray or oil
Instructions:
1. In a large bowl, mash the cooked lentils using a fork.
2. Add the chopped mushrooms, oats, tomato paste,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per to the mashed lentils. Mix well.
3. Add the beaten egg (or flaxseed equivalent) and mix until a sticky dough forms.
4. Divide the mixture into 4-6 portions, depending on desired patty size.
5. Shape each portion into a ball and then flatten slightly into patties.
6. Cook the burgers in a non-stick skillet or grill over medium-high heat for about 4-5 minutes per side, until golden brown and crispy.
Cooking Time: 8-10 minutes
Red Lentil and Kale Salad with Lemon Dressing
This salad is a vibrant and flavorful combination of red lentils, curly kale, and a tangy lemon dressing. Perfect for a light and healthy lunch or dinner.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 cups curly kale leaves, stems removed and discarded, leaves torn into bite-sized pieces
– 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
Instructions:
1. Cook the lentils according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
2. In a large bowl, massage the kale leaves with your hands for about 2 minutes to soften them.
3. In a small bowl, whisk together lemon juice, olive oil,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per.
4. Add the cooked lentils, chopped parsley, and dressing to the bowl with the kale. Toss to combine.
5. Serve immediately or refrigerate for up to 24 hours.
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es (including cooking time for lentils)
Red Lentil and Carrot Soup with Ginger
This flavorful soup is perfect for a chilly evening. The combination of red lentils, carrots, and ginger creates a soothing and nutritious meal.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ils
– 2 medium carrots, chopped
– 2 inches fresh ginger, peeled and grated
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h cilantro leaves for garnish (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té the grated ginger in a little water until fragrant.
2. Add the chopped carrots and cook until they start to soften, about 5 minutes.
3. Add the red lentils, vegetable broth, and diced tomatoes.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 20-25 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
4.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
5.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ro leaves if desired.
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es
Red Lentil and Chickpea Stew
This warming stew is a flavorful blend of red lentils, chickpeas, and aromatic spices, perfect for a cozy night in. With its comforting texture and rich flavor profile, it’s sure to become a favorite.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 cups water or vegetable broth
– 1 can (14 oz)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
– 1 on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Fresh parsley, chopped (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té the onion and garlic until softened.
2. Add the lentils, chickpeas, c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ir to combine.
3. Pour in the water or broth and bring to a boil.
4. Re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 30-40 minutes, or until the lentils are tender.
5.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
6. Serve hot, garnished with chopped parsley if desired.
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es
Red Lentil and Quinoa Stuffed Peppers
A nutritious and flavorful twist on traditional stuffed peppers, this recipe combines the comforting warmth of red lentils with the nutty goodness of quinoa. Per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a special occasion.
Ingredients:
– 4 bell peppers, any color
– 1 cup cooked red lentils
– 1/2 cup cooked quinoa
– 1 onion, finely ch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 cup vegetable broth
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 teaspoon cumin
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Chopped fresh cilantro, for garnish (optional)
Instructions:
1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
2. Cut the tops off the peppers and remove seeds and membranes.
3. In a large bowl, combine cooked lentils, quinoa, onion, garlic, vegetable broth, olive oil, cumin, salt, and pepper. Mix well.
4. Stuff each pepper with the lentil-quinoa mixture, filling to the top.
5. Place stuffed peppers in a baking dish and cover with aluminum foil.
6. Bake for 30 minutes, then remove foil and bake an additional 15-20 minutes or until peppers are tender.
Cooking Time: 45-50 minutes
Red Lentil and Coconut Curry
A flavorful and nutritious curry made with red lentils, coconut milk, and a blend of aromatic spices.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 medium onions, chopped
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tablespoon grated fresh ginger
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on curry powder
– 1/2 teaspoon turmeric
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 1 can (14 oz) coconut milk
– 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
– Fresh cilantro leaves, chopped (optional)
Instructions:
1. In a large saucepan, heat the oil over medium heat. Add the onions and cook until softened, about 5 minutes.
2. Add the garlic, ginger, cumin, curry powder, turmeric, and salt. C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ly.
3. Add the lentils and stir to combine. Cook for 1-2 minutes.
4. Pour in the coconut milk and bring the mixture to a simmer.
5. Reduce heat to low and cook, covered, for 20-25 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
6. Serve hot, garnished with chopped cilantro leaves if desired.
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es
Red Lentil and Pumpkin Soup
This comforting soup is a perfect blend of fall flavors, with the natural sweetness of pumpkin and the earthiness of red lentils. Serve warm with crusty bread for a satisfying meal.
Ingredients:
– 1 medium on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 small pumpkin (about 1 lb), peeled, seeded, and chopped
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
– 1 tsp ground cumin
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Optional: fresh cilantro leaves for garnish
Instructions:
1. In a large pot, sauté the onion and garlic until softened.
2. Add the pumpkin, lentils, broth, tomatoes, and cumin.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 30 minutes or until the lentils are tender.
3.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
4. Serve warm, garnished with fresh cilantro leaves if desired.
Cooking Time: 45-50 minutes
Red Lentil and Spinach Dip
This flavorful dip is perfect for snacking or serving at your next gathering. Made with red lentils, spinach, and a hint of cumin, it’s a delicious and healthy option that’s sure to please.
Ingredients:
– 1 cup dried red lentils, rinsed and drained
– 2 cups water
– 1/4 cup chopped fresh spinach
– 1/4 cup plain Greek yogurt
– 1 tablespoon lemon juice
– 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
–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
1. In a medium saucepan, combine lentils and water.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 20-25 minutes or until lentils are tender.
2. Drain and rinse lentils with cold water. Let cool slightly.
3. In a blender or food processor, combine cooked lentils, spinach, yogurt, lemon juice, cumin, salt, and pepper. Blend until smooth.
4.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ow flavors to meld.
5. Serve chilled with pita chips, crackers, or vegetables.
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es (lentils) + 30 minutes (refrigeration)
